Transaction 327413f8401d7160ab1eb0e655922e833dc4274601e04aa557450577ae5a76dc

1 Input
2 Outputs
  • 327413f8401d7160ab1eb0e655922e833dc4274601e04aa557450577ae5a76dc:0
  • value  616500
    address  35u8TbYbqDPGZX5ZSNpJDuwoLsfCMJwsQ4
  • 327413f8401d7160ab1eb0e655922e833dc4274601e04aa557450577ae5a76dc:1
  • value  37791229
    address  32m3w6g1uT2dHaKaC9UbuuKNP4xfbH2x5T